We are looking for an analyst to work on our global capital markets team. The analyst will have responsibility for many parts of the deal process, including:
- Performing due diligence including valuation analysis for primary, secondary, and other capital market offerings
- Representing the firm at meetings with corporate management teams and sell-side syndicate desks
- Working with our global team to expand the firm's presence in new areas within capital markets
- Interacting with sell-side sales and research contacts
- Precisely communicating valuation changes and investment theses to global trading teams in time sensitive environments
- Developing and evaluating trade ideas that involve fundamental catalysts or valuation insights
- 5+ years of relevant experience analyzing securities (Investment Banking, Equity Research, Buy Side or similar), with significant experience working on capital markets transactions
- Undergraduate university degree (BS/BA equivalent) or graduate work in a quantitative field is strongly preferred
- Effective communicator
- Intellectually curious
- Familiarity with accounting, financial statement analysis and financial modeling
- Fluency in English and Mandarin Chinese required

Jane Street works differently. As a liquidity provider and market maker, we trade on more than 200 trading venues across 45 countries and help form the backbone of global markets. Our approach is rooted in technology and rigorous quantitative analysis, but our success is driven by our people.
